Rain in the culture of different countries
All over the world, people have different attitudes to rain, which is not surprising, because the climate in different countries of the world is different. For people living in arid regions, rainfall becomes a manifestation of grace from above, in such territories you can often hear about gods commanding the elements. And for people whose climate can be classified as moderately or very humid, rain is not something special and carries universal grace. In this regard, depending on the origin and nationality, each person will have their own idea of ​​what rain is in the artistic style of literature.
Word origin story
There are several versions of the origin of the word "rain", which are the eternal subject of discussion between historians. According to one guess, it came from the Norwegian and Swedish languages, in which there are expressions similar in sound and meaning. According to another version, the word is originally Slavic, based on it is the Indo-European root dheus, which translates as "spray in the air."
What is art-style rain?
Without a doubt, the image of rain in the literature of the 19th-21st centuries plays a huge role and takes on the function of creating a common atmosphere in the air. Description of the rain in an artistic style reflects the emotional state of the characters, is able to escalate or, conversely, dispel the tense atmosphere. Each writer has this weather phenomenon - his own individual idea and vision of what is happening, in which he puts a part of himself.
The description of the rain in the artistic style accompanies both deep sadness and the unprecedented joy of the lyrical hero, depending on the means of expression that are used in the text. At the same time, the author uses numerous epithets, metaphors and personifications that give the episode a character and make the reader feel more deeply everything that is happening in the work.
The image of rain in the artistic style has always served as a source of inspiration for people of art, like a mirror of the character’s soul. Sometimes rain washed away all the pain, resentment, bitterness and frustration of the character, and in other cases inspired people, reinforcing their faith, hope and happiness.
